You see, a valve seems like just a valve, but a ball valve&#8217;s design will be the reason for your system thriving or failing under pressure.<\/p>\n<p><strong>How It Works<\/strong><\/p>\n<p>Simply put, the main element of a ball valve is a hollow, perforated, and rotatable ball used for opening and closing the flow. When it is open, the ball&#8217;s hole aligns with the flow, but when it is closed, turning the valve handle moves the ball by 90 degrees so that its hole is perpendicular to the flow. This is not only beautiful and quick but also practically indestructible. However, simple here does not mean the same solution for everyone.<\/p>\n<p><strong>Floating Ball or Trunnion Mounted<\/strong><\/p>\n<p>The discussion on this point usually creates some interest.<\/p>\n<ul>\n<li>Floating Ball Valves: Two elastomeric seats hold the ball and, under pressure, it &#8220;floats&#8221; a little further downstream which helps to form an even tighter seal with the downstream seat. Ideal for low-pressure and small pipe size applications.<\/li>\n<li>Trunnion Mounted Ball Valves: The ball is held in place by a trunnion shaft at the bottom and by the stem at the top. This is a heavyweight type. Basically, it is the solution for high-pressure, large-diameter lines because it is the seats that move to the ball and not the ball that moves to the seats. The load is borne by the stem thus the seals are free from it.<\/li>\n<\/ul>\n<p><strong>Full Bore vs. Reduced Bore<\/strong><\/p>\n<p>Many times I have found it difficult to explain. A Full Bore valve consists of a ball with an orifice of the same diameter as that of the pipe. There is no restriction, the pressure drop is very low. Reduced Bore (or Standard Port) has a smaller hole. It is more economical and lighter but this results in higher flow resistance. When line pigging is involved or you require maximum flow efficiency, Full Bore is the way to go.<\/p>\n<p><strong>Industrial Applications: The Domains of These Field Mates<\/strong><\/p>\n<p>Ball valves can be at a milk processing plant, as well as, working on an oil rig in the sea. They owe their popularity and versatility to their being found almost everywhere.<\/p>\n<ul>\n<li>Oil and Gas Industry: They have the highest rank in &#8220;shut-off&#8221; or &#8220;stop&#8221; operation. The already mentioned bubble-tight shut-off capability is a must for both up-stream production and downstream refining.<\/li>\n<li>Chemical Processing Industry: This is where the knowledge of material science is the winner. When acid bath is on the way, the ball valve manufacturer has to be knowledgeable in exotic alloys as well as in specialized liners and coatings.<\/li>\n<li>Water Treatment: The main focus here is on achieving reliable and long-lasting performance. Valves that have been kept in the same position for months and suddenly seized will be unacceptable to you.<\/li>\n<li>Power Generation: The valves should perfectly match the safety codes set by the regulatory bodies because the temperatures and pressures are very high.<\/li>\n<\/ul>\n<p><strong>Establishing Your &#8220;Must Have&#8221; List: High-Setting You\u2019re Standards<\/strong><\/p>\n<p>In case you are planning to purchase your valves in India, then the exercise of getting your ends meet will be quite long. Right at the time of the quote consideration, you should have your technical points of reference clearly understood.<\/p>\n<p><strong>Step 1: The Technical Specs (Don&#8217;t Wing It)<\/strong><\/p>\n<p>Even if you are not an engineer, you should always have a technical specification sheet as detailed as possible when ordering ball valves.<\/p>\n<ul>\n<li>Level of Purity of Materials: Be it Stainless Steel 316, Carbon Steel or even something like Monel metal, the chemical composition of the metal is very important. &#8220;Dubious&#8221; metallurgy results in stress corrosion cracking.<\/li>\n<li>Seating Materials: Are you still using PTFE, reinforced Teflon, or metal-to-metal seats? It all depends on your temperature and media &#8220;dirtiness&#8221; levels.<\/li>\n<li>Pressure Bearing: Always check that the valve you buy can withstand even your highest pressure scenario, not just the pressures you normally operate at.<\/li>\n<\/ul>\n<p><strong>Step 2: Certifications, Your First Line of Defense<\/strong><\/p>\n<p>With the Indian manufacturer, you don&#8217;t get just documents; you get the manufacturer&#8217;s commitment to the performance of the product through certification. So, if the manufacturer should happen to hide his certificates from you or if he tells you, &#8220;We are working on it.&#8221;&#8216; Just walk away<\/p>\n<ul>\n<li>API 6D Certified: This is the most important certification for a pipeline valve. If your business is related to Oil and Gas, this document is a must-have.<\/li>\n<li>ISO 9001:2015 Certified: This tells that they have a quality management system that is consistent.<\/li>\n<li>Safety Integrity Level: It is a necessity if the valve is a part of a Safety Instrumented System (SIS).<\/li>\n<li>Fire Safe Certification (API 607): In the case of a fire, the soft seats may get burnt and the valve is still expected to seal. You most certainly want to know the answer to that question before the fire happens.<\/li>\n<\/ul>\n<p><strong>The Vetting Process: Beyond Popularity<\/strong><\/p>\n<p>In my working life, I have gone through numerous brochures.<\/p>\n<p>While hobbling through various documentation, most of them seem really good. We all have budgets. Still, you will find available quotations for valves on the Indian market that are 20% or 30% below the industry-standard prices. That is very tempting. Honestly, it is a siren song. However, the question is: where is the saving going to come from?<\/p>\n<p>Usually, it is the places you cannot see until it is too late:<\/p>\n<ul>\n<li>Thinner Walls: Slightly thinner valve bodies than required may pass a one-time pressure test but will probably fail after six months of thermal cycling.<\/li>\n<li>Lower-Grade Seals: At first look, they are really like the genuine article but they drop off much faster and the resulting leaks will cost you thousands in lost product or environmental fines.<\/li>\n<li>Poor Machining: If the ball and seat don&#8217;t have a perfect &#8220;mate, &#8221; you&#8217;ll never get a true shut-off.<\/li>\n<\/ul>\n<p>My suggestion? Do not go for the cheapest deal. Set your target for those that play by the rules. If you compare the quotes of the big players like L&amp;T, Flowserve, or reputable regional players, you might find some prices significantly lower, which in turn, should sound alarm bells. Remember that base materials for all the players are the same, the only place one can save that kind of money is by cutting corners.<\/p>\n<p><strong>The Long Game: Partnership and After Sales Support<\/strong><\/p>\n<p>In fact, a ball valve is not simply a commodity; it is continual occupant of your plant.
